From J. F. Galbraith   20 October 1881

thumbnail

Summary

Recounts a remarkable incident of development of worms in a barrel of wheat. Sends his account, having pondered CD’s view that plants and animals may have had a common ancestor.

Author:  Julius Frazelle Galbraith
Addressee:  Charles Robert Darwin
Date:  20 Oct 1881
Classmark:  DAR 165: 3
Letter no:  DCP-LETT-13417
